About Us

The G’day Group comprises three leading Australian tourism brands in Discovery Parks, G’day Parks and loyalty program G’day Rewards. Employing more than 2,200 people Australia-wide, G’day Group has a truly national footprint of over 300 holiday parks, including 85 fully owned and operated parks and Resorts. The largest park network in the country, we’re about authentic Australian holiday experiences and inviting all Aussies to say g’day to more of Australia.

We’re on a journey of growth and evolution to reshape the industry, offering the best customer experience underpinned by the best technology. Each year, we showcase the true Australia to millions of guests and we are the co-custodians of some of the country’s most treasured places; a privilege we don’t take lightly. With eyes on domestic and regional tourism like never before, we are building a passionate, adaptable, high-performance team to create holiday memories that put a smile in every g’day.

About The Role

We are seeking a highly motivated and experienced Senior Town Planner to join our team. The Senior Town Planner will lead and manage the planning and development processes for various urban and regional projects. This role requires a deep understanding of urban planning principles, strong analytical skills, and the ability to navigate complex regulatory frameworks across multiple jurisdictions. The ideal candidate will be proactive, detail-oriented, and passionate about creating sustainable and vibrant communities.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Lead the development and implementation of comprehensive planning strategies and policies to guide urban and regional development projects.
  • Conduct research, data analysis, and demographic studies to assess community needs, growth trends, and environmental impacts.
  • Collaborate with government agencies, stakeholders, and community groups to gather input, address concerns, and promote consensus-building in the planning process.
  • Prepare and review zoning ordinances, land use regulations, and development proposals to ensure compliance with local, state, and federal regulations.
  • Evaluate development proposals, site plans, and subdivision plans for conformance with land use plans, zoning regulations, and design standards.
  • Conduct environmental assessments and impact studies to identify potential risks and opportunities associated with development projects.
  • Provide expert advice and guidance to project teams, elected officials, and community members on planning-related matters.
  • Manage the preparation and presentation of planning reports, presentations, and recommendations to planning commissions, city councils, and other governing bodies.
  • Supervise and mentor junior planners and support staff, providing training, feedback, and professional development opportunities.
  • Stay informed about emerging trends, best practices, and legislative changes in the field of urban planning and apply knowledge to enhance planning processes and outcomes.
